Understanding Surfactant Leaching in Bathroom Environments
Surfactant leaching occurs when cleaning agents release surfactants—detergents and surfactants—that gradually migrate through porous materials like grout, tiles, and sealants. This migration weakens structural bonds, promotes microbial growth, and accelerates surface degradation. High humidity and frequent water exposure in bathrooms intensify this process, making regular maintenance essential for healthy indoor environments.

Proven Strategies to Prevent Surfactant Leaching in Bathrooms
Prevention starts with selecting low-residue, biodegradable cleaners formulated without harsh surfactants. Regular sealing of grout and surfaces creates a barrier against chemical penetration. Opting for breathable, moisture-resistant materials like ceramic tiles and sealed stone reduces leaching risks. Routine maintenance, including prompt drying and periodic deep cleaning, ensures long-term durability and hygiene in bathroom spaces.
